Structural and molecular basis of FAN1 defects in promoting Huntington's disease
2024-11-04
Abstract excerpt
<title>Abstract</title> <p>FAN1 is a DNA dependent nuclease whose proper function is essential for maintaining human health. For example, a genetic variant in FAN1, Arg507 to His hastens onset of Huntington’s disease, a repeat expansion disorder for which there is no cure.
